Final Finishing is considering three mutually exclusive alternatives for a new polisher. Each alternative has an expected life of 10 years and no salvage value.

Polisher 1 requires an initial investment of $20,000 and provides annual benefits of $4,465.
Polisher 2 requires an initial investment of $10,000 and provides annual benefits of $1,770.

Polisher 3 requires an initial investment of $15,000 and provides annual benefits of $3,580. MARR is 15%/year.

Find the IRR for the comparison polisher 1 versus polisher 3.
